Claims (11)
- 糸加工に使用される糸パッケージからの弾性糸の引き出し方法であって、
(a)弾性糸を含む糸パッケージを提供することと、
(b)糸加工装置における前記糸の速度の、駆動ローラの速度に対する比によって決定されたドラフトにおいて、該駆動ローラから該糸加工装置に、前記糸パッケージから前記弾性糸を引き出すことと、
(c)前記弾性糸の張力を測定することと、
(d)前記張力が臨界レベルに達したときにアラームを与えることと、を含み、
前記アラームが、該駆動ローラの速度を増大することによって該弾性糸のドラフトの張力を減少するための信号を提供する、方法。 - 前記臨界レベルが臨界高張力レベルまたは臨界低張力レベルを有する、請求項1の方法。
- 前記ドラフトが約1.5〜約5.5である、請求項1の方法。
- 前記臨界高張力レベルが約0.0981cN/デシテックス以上である、請求項2の方法。
- 前記臨界低張力レベルが約0.01962cN/デシテックスである、請求項2の方法。
- 前記臨界レベルが臨界高張力レベルであるときに、前記アラームが音響アラームまたは視覚アラームを有する、請求項1に記載の方法。
- 該ドラフトを減少するための前記信号が、前記張力が前記臨界レベルに達したときに前記ドラフトを自動調節することを含む、請求項1の方法。
- 前記ドラフトが前記糸加工装置の速度を減少することによって減少される、請求項1の方法。
- (f)前記ドラフトを減少した後に前記張力を測定することと、
(g)張力を前記臨界点未満に減少した後に、ドラフトを増大することと、をさらに含む、請求項1の方法。 - 前記弾性糸が抗粘着添加剤を含む、請求項1の方法。
- 前記アラームが、前記弾性糸が切断され得ることを人間オペレータに警告する、請求項1の方法。
